19 int mime_encode_as_qp(const char *input, char *output, int outlen)
20 {
21 int ret = 1;
22 char *o = output;
23 const unsigned char *i = (const unsigned char*)input;
24 while (1) {
25 int c = *i;
26 if (c == '\0') {
27 break;
28 }
29 else if ((c & 0x80) || (c == '=') || (is_control_character(c))) {
30 if (outlen >= 3) {
31 snprintf(o, outlen, "=%02X", c);
32 outlen -= 3;
33 o += 3;
34 }
35 else
36 outlen = 0;
37 ret += 3;
38 }
39 else {
40 if (outlen >= 1) {
41 snprintf(o, outlen, "%c", c);
42 outlen -= 1;
43 o += 1;
44 }
45 ret += 1;
46 }
47 ++i;
48 }
49 return ret;
50 }

99 int mime_decode_from_qp(const char *input, char *output, int outlen)
100 {
101 int ret = 1;
102 char *o = output;
103 const unsigned char *i = (const unsigned char*)input;
104 while (1) {
105 unsigned int c = *i;
106 if (c == '\0') {
107 break;
108 }
109 else if (c & 0x80) {
110 /* The high bit is never set in quoted-printable encoding! */
111 return -EDOM;
112 }
113 else if (c == '=') {
114 int high = hexchar_to_int(*++i);
115 if (high < 0)
116 return -EINVAL;
117 int low = hexchar_to_int(*++i);
118 if (low < 0)
119 return -EINVAL;
120 c = (high << 4) + low;
121 }
122 ++i;
123
124 if (outlen >= 1) {
125 snprintf(o, outlen, "%c", c);
126 outlen -= 1;
127 o += 1;
128 }
129 ret += 1;
130 }
131 return ret;
132 }
